Several families from Gaza are set to relocate to the United Kingdom, marking a significant shift in their circumstances. The move comes amid ongoing regional tensions and humanitarian concerns in Gaza, where residents have faced longstanding economic and security challenges.

The UK government has announced plans to facilitate the relocation process, citing commitments to provide safety and support for those affected by the conflict. Exact numbers of families involved and the timeline for their relocation have not been disclosed, but officials have emphasized their willingness to assist vulnerable populations.

Humanitarian organizations have welcomed the initiative, viewing it as a potential relief for families seeking refuge. However, critics have raised questions about the long-term integration and support these families will receive in the UK, alongside broader debates about migration policies.

The relocation effort underscores ongoing international efforts to address the humanitarian impact of the conflict in Gaza. As the situation develops, many will be watching how the move proceeds and how it fits into larger regional responses.
